Abstract: (Abstract) Saint Leo University is truly attuned to the needs of Adult students. Many combine traditional classes meeting two evenings per week with the online classes, thus allowing them to pursue a degree full time without jeopardizing careers and family. The eight-week terms allow military and civilian students to craft an education plan that fits into deployment, training, and work schedules. Saint Leo Faculty members are acutely aware of the problems associated with a fluid schedule, and work with students to complete coursework without any compromise of academic quality.
